The National Missing and Unidentified Persons System (NamUs)

Unidentified Person / NamUs #UP8347
Male, White / Caucasian
Date Body Found: August 25, 2008
Location Found: Ridgefield Park, New Jersey

Circumstances
Type: Unidentified Deceased
Date Body Found: August 25, 2008
NamUs Case Created: January 4, 2011
ME/C QA Reviewed: January 5, 2011
Location Found: Ridgefield Park, New Jersey
County: Bergen County

Circumstances of Recovery
Found at a construction site in Challenger Park, Ridgefield Park, NJ.

Details of Recovery
Torso not recovered
One or more limbs not recovered
One or both hands not recovered
Condition of Remains:
Not recognizable - Partial skeletal parts only
